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$160.44 | 5.539% | $169.3268 | $169.33 | $169.35 | $169.30 |
Purchase #2 | $189.47 | 9.555% | $207.5739 | $207.57 | $207.55 | $207.60 |
Purchase #3 | $147.39 | 13.575% | $167.3982 | $167.40 | $167.40 | $167.40 |
Purchase #4 | $127.59 | 13.397% | $144.6832 | $144.68 | $144.70 | $144.70 |
Purchase #5 | $97.49 | 8.381% | $105.6606 | $105.66 | $105.65 | $105.70 |
Purchase #6 | $94.30 | 9.450% | $103.2114 | $103.21 | $103.20 | $103.20 |
Purchase #7 | $112.72 | 10.534% | $124.5939 | $124.59 | $124.60 | $124.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$929.40 | $1,022.4480 | $1,022.44 | $1,022.45 | $1,022.50 |
